Remya Narayanan is a scholar working on Polymers and Plastics, Electrical and Electronic Engineering and Materials Chemistry. According to data from OpenAlex, Remya Narayanan has authored 16 papers receiving a total of 372 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Polymers and Plastics, 9 papers in Electrical and Electronic Engineering and 8 papers in Materials Chemistry. Recurrent topics in Remya Narayanan’s work include Quantum Dots Synthesis And Properties (8 papers), Conducting polymers and applications (7 papers) and Transition Metal Oxide Nanomaterials (6 papers). Remya Narayanan is often cited by papers focused on Quantum Dots Synthesis And Properties (8 papers), Conducting polymers and applications (7 papers) and Transition Metal Oxide Nanomaterials (6 papers). Remya Narayanan collaborates with scholars based in India, United Kingdom and Germany. Remya Narayanan's co-authors include Melepurath Deepa, Avanish Kumar Srivastava, P. Naresh Kumar, Musthafa Ottakam Thotiyl, Bijivemula N. Reddy, Debanjan Chakraborty, Sattwick Haldar, S. M. Shivaprasad and Amrita Das and has published in prestigious journals such as The Journal of Physical Chemistry C, Journal of Materials Chemistry A and Nanoscale.
